Is this an easy A?
Older reviews suggest she helps students succeed, but recent reviews show heavy homework and uncertain grading outcomes.
All grade and effort evidence comes from in-person reviews.
Is the course easy?
Students describe helpful ESL support and low pressure in older classes, but ESL251 appears more demanding.
Only in-person reviews describe course difficulty.
Is attendance flexible?
The clearest recent ESL251 reviews say attendance was mandatory, while older reviews do not clarify attendance.
Attendance evidence comes only from in-person reviews.
Is this professor recommended?
Recommendation is split because older reviews are very enthusiastic but the newest explicit would-take-again responses are negative.
Only in-person reviews are available, and the strongest conflict is between old praise and recent criticism.
